Educational Development Corporation, a publishing company, operates as a trade co-publisher of educational children's books in the United States.
Educational Development stock last closed at $1.20, down 10.01% from the previous day, and has decreased 42.91% in one year. It has underperformed other stocks in the Publishing industry by 0.36 percentage points. Educational Development stock is currently +29.58% from its 52-week low of $0.92, and -51.97% from its 52-week high of $2.49.
At the moment, there are 8.58M shares of EDUC outstanding. The market value of EDUC is $10.27M. In the past 24 hours, 4049 EDUC shares were traded.

Total EDUC debt is lower than 5 years ago, relative to shareholder equity.
There are more short-term assets than short-term liabilities on the EDUC balance sheet.
There are more short-term assets than long-term liabilities on the EDUC balance sheet.
Negative Health Checks:
EDUC profit margin has gone down from 0.4% to -15.1% in the past year.
EDUC has a relatively high debt to equity ratio of 1.
EDUC earnings of -$5.28M is not sufficient to cover its interest payments.
EDUC's operating cash flow of $1.91M allows it to safely service it's debt of $32.68M.

Last year, EDUC revenue was $36.52M. In the last five year, EDUC's revenue has grown by -20.7% per year. This was slower than the Publishing industry average of 1.36%.
No, Educational Development doesn't provide an income stream by paying out dividends.

There are two main options:
Market order: A market order is an order to buy or sell a security at the best price on the market. Market orders are mostly fine.
Limit order: A limit order allows you to buy or sell a stock at a specific price (or better). If you want to make sure you're buying or selling at a given dollar amount, place a limit order.
